People who have mesothelioma typically work in environments in which asbestos is present. They may have worked in critical manufacturing facilities or as insulation workers or in shipyards where asbestos was used on ships, pipes and other equipment. They might have been exposed directly to asbestos materials, or be ill due to breathing in contaminated air or from laundering work clothing that came into contact with asbestos dust.

Mesothelioma cases can be filed as personal injury claims or lawsuits for wrongful death. They may have multiple defendants as asbestos companies usually provided a variety of asbestos-related items in various states. Lawyers for mesothelioma will examine the corporate documents of asbestos-related companies to determine the date and time when asbestos exposure occurred. They will determine which state is best to file the claim.
Lawsuits can be settled outside of court or taken to trial. Most mesothelioma cases are resolved without a court. Most asbestos companies cannot defend themselves in a mesothelioma lawsuit and will compensate the victims to get out of a lengthy trial.
When a lawsuit goes to trial, the jury will determine how the victim is awarded. Damages are usually divided into two categories: noneconomic and economic. Economic damages include documented treatment costs as well as loss of wages and other documented costs associated with the diagnosis. Noneconomic damages are based on the plaintiff's suffering and pain and may be awarded together with economic damages.
